hi all. I have been playing around basic ba automation for the past couple of months and I have just ventured into signals and stored values .........phew, mind bogling !!!! could some one please tell me if it is possible to put the current "green all selections " amount into stored values? thanx in advance. have a nice day! :-)

Stored values can't look at the 'green all' amount but if your wanting to green up when it reaches a certain value then that can be done with a 'Profit Condition' as detailed in this thread

Timers are easy to implement in Guardian.
Create ...
1. a rule to increment a signal IF the condition you want to time has been met. And have that rule firing once per second.
2. a rule to reset the timer signal to zero if the trigger condition no longer exists.
3. a rule to perform an action if the timer signal exceeds your chosen time limit value, and to reset the timer signal.

Programming is just a matter of breaking down into the smallest possible parts what you'd subconsiously do if you did it manually, and then writing a process for each step. It requires you to think about how we think, rather than just 'thinking'.
